JAPANESE AMBASSADOR PAYS COURTESY CALL ON DR. ALIE KABBA

The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ary of Japan the Republic of Sierra Leone with resident in Ghana, His Excellency Tuslomu Himeno has a paid a Courtesy call on the Minister of Foreign Affairs and International Cooperation, Dr. Alie Kabba at his Tower Hill office in Freetown.
According to H.E Himeno, his visit is to congratulate the Minister on his appointment and to further strengthen the existing bilateral relationship between both countries, and to broaden and deepen Japan’s continues support to the realization of President Julius Maada Bio’s New Direction.
The Ambassador informed and extended an invite to Dr. Alie Kabba to participate in the Tokyo International Conference on African Development (TICAD) meeting in Japan, scheduled in October this year as a preparatory meeting for the Summit of Heads of State meetings next year 2019.
Dr. Alie Kabba welcomed the Ambassador and highlighted some of the key objects of the New Direction which the government is poised to deliver. He assured the Japanese Ambassador of his Ministry’s cooperation with the Republic of Japan in enhancing Economic Diplomacy.
Some of the issues discussed during the meeting focused on the enhancement of: Japanese Government Scholarships, humanitarian assistance and energy.
